Output 61efc5bff8dd2856d2ac2ecd449524411b3c249c8a4881f626a8369eb92a39a6:18

value
16926
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6aae7d4678519576ad19d09012df22df2ebacdbbf81763d36ae3e2ddb7e30b9c
address
bc1pd2h863nc2x2hdtge6zgp9hezmuht4ndmlqtk85m2u03dmdlrpwwqmu5atv
transaction
61efc5bff8dd2856d2ac2ecd449524411b3c249c8a4881f626a8369eb92a39a6
spent
true